Pros & cons summary


Recency 10 September 2017 6 January 2025
Physical cores 12 6
Threads 24 12
Chip lithography 14 nm 4 nm
Power consumption (TDP) 140 Watt 28 Watt

i9-7920X has 100% more physical cores and 100% more threads.

Ryzen 5 PRO 230, on the other hand, has an age advantage of 7 years, a 250% more advanced lithography process, and 400% lower power consumption.

We couldn't decide between Intel Core i9-7920X and AMD Ryzen 5 PRO 230. We've got no test results to judge.

Note that Core i9-7920X is a desktop processor while Ryzen 5 PRO 230 is a notebook one.
